The Royal Caribbean Spectrum of the Seas
More than 4,200 people can comfortably sail on this highly-rated Quantum Ultra class ship, based in Shanghai and refurbished only two years ago in 2024.
Want to learn to surf on the Flowrider artificial surf wave, fly like a bird in an indoor skydiving chamber, experience the future at a bar with a robotic bartender, or see the views from the Northstar observation capsule? These amenities are offered exclusively by Royal Caribbean and are all found aboard the Spectrum of the Seas Royal Caribbean. In addition, experience rare attractions like a trampoline park, a bumper car track, and a roller skating rink.
The Spectrum of the Seas Royal Caribbean also offers a ping pong table, an outdoor movie theater, a gym, a casino, a solarium, and a spa.
